Chateau Trigance is located in the beautiful Gorge du Verdon region that makes for great day trips but offers peace and tranquility like you have never experienced. You feel like you are alone with only goats and a few towns people for many miles! The chateau has only 10 rooms so there is never a crowd and we have met many nice people over the years. Enjoy an aperitif on the terrace and watch the sunset before dinner. The food is WORLD CLASS!! Three fixed priced menus or a la carte choices to die for! The Thomas family are the owners (and the people who won a gold metal from the French govermement for restoring this historic chateau!) and are always there to make sure your every wish is taken care of. My wife is diabetic and they catered to her every need as far as food preprations, making beautiful dishes not on the menu!! Ask Guillaume (William in English) to select a wine to suit your pallette and the meal you are enjoying. He will never steer you wrong or steer you to expensive wines. The breakfast are wonderful as well.The quaint village sits below the chateau with several artisians and friendly shop keepers. We have found it to be a great starting point for a french vacation. We fly into Paris and on to Nice (almost the same cost as only to Paris), renting a car, driving to Trigance (about 2 hours north of Nice but easy driving). Plan on spending at least 2-3 nights to really get into "la bon vie" the GOOD LIFE! Cost?? A TRUE bargain for rooms and the food!! This will be 12 years we have returned, what else can I say?
